Hi guys, need some of your help! My cousin has a 1.8TQS and is experiencing some bad juddering under throttle. Most of the times when he pulls out of a junction or when he tries full throttle it judders as if the car is about to cut off!? I got it around mine, took the spark plugs out and it was all black- indication of over fueling?! checked the air filter for blockages cleaned the box, and put newish sparks in there. any idea if this linked to something else? I was thinking the fuel filter maybe choked but it seems fine sometimes. He said to me that its kind of ok when its cold, its when its warm it really does that!

Had similar experience recently and one of the coils was on it's way out it developed into a misfire at idle and then I just disconnected the coils one by one to determine which one was at fault. Failing that it may be the dual mass flywheel !!
 
Change the coolant temperature sender on the back of the head. It's probably telling the ECU it's running in cold start mode.

Even if the dash says its ok for temp, the sender can still be faulty as its a 2 part unit. One section for ECU, one for dash
